Bitget App
Trade smarter
Buy cryptoMarketsTradeCopyBotsEarnWeb3
New Listings
API3 (API3): Decentralized APIs Planning to Replace Third-Party Oracles in Blockchain

API3 (API3): Decentralized APIs Planning to Replace Third-Party Oracles in Blockchain

Beginner
2024-01-31 | 5m

What is API3 (API3)?

API3 is a decentralized protocol that allows dApps to get access to external data and services without compromising decentralization. At its core, API3 aims to replace third-party oracles with fully decentralized and blockchain-native APIs known as dAPIs. Such dAPIs are operated by the source-level data provider on the native chain, so users always know where the data come from and can avoid the problems of single point of failure caused by cross-chain bridges. API3 considers this a crucial step in enhancing the security and reliability of decentralized systems.

How API3 (API3) Works

API3 fetches off-chain data for dApps in a secure manner with dAPIs, a safety net called collateralized service coverage, and a DAO.

dAPIs

In decentralized systems, oracles often act as the bridge between on-chain smart contracts and off-chain data. However, relying on third-party oracles has significant risks because they use middlemen, raise costs of operation, lack transparency, and introduce more opportunities for bad actors. API3 addresses this by offering dAPIs, which are decentralized and blockchain-native APIs. Instead of going through middlemen or complicated processes, dAPIs act as a direct link. They fetch data from the regular internet, the same way you check the weather on your phone or look up the latest news. It's a straightforward and efficient process - no extra steps, no unnecessary complications.

Collateralized Service Coverage

Collateralized Service Coverage by API3 is like an insurance policy but tailor-made for your dApps. API3 sets up a pool of funds which act as collateral, ensuring that if anything unexpected happens, you're protected. If your dApp suffers due to a malfunction in the dAPI and you can prove it, API3 has your back. They've got a predetermined amount ready from the pools to cover those damages. This way, you're not left in the lurch when something goes wrong.

The Collateralized Service Coverage is a collaborative effort between API3 and Kleros, a dispute resolution protocol. Together, they build an on-chain insurance-like service coverage product. This collaboration allows for trustless insurance-like coverage, ensuring transparency and fairness for users of API3.

In the event of a malfunction caused by dAPI, users can make on-chain service coverage claims. The API3 DAO can either pay the claimed amount, propose a settlement, or escalate the claim to the Kleros court for resolution.

DAO Governance

The API3 DAO plays a pivotal role in governing the API3 ecosystem. DAO members, who hold the native API3 tokens, actively participate in decision-making processes related to service coverage, risk assessment, and overall project development. Through decentralized decision making of the DAO, API3 addresses the problems arising from centralized governance and oracles.

The DAO is like the big boss overseeing everything. To keep things simple and cost-effective, when a task becomes too big for one team, it's assigned to a subDAO - a smaller group with specific expertise. This team-based approach is efficient and ensures that the right people handle the right tasks. For critical tasks like managing dAPIs, a subDAO can act swiftly based on their expertise. As API3 grows, more layers of subDAOs may be added, so the operation of each subDAO and of the protocol as a whole can be handled effectively.

The DAO operates on two key principles:

● First, the "principle of least privilege" ensures that teams have the minimum authority needed. To prevent any team from causing major havoc, each team's authority is carefully restricted. It's like giving them just enough power to get the job done without risking misuse. Additionally, teams receive funds based on milestones and deliverables, ensuring they have what they need without excess.

● Second, transparency is crucial. Teams provide detailed reports to the DAO, promoting accountability and allowing everyone to see how API3 operates.

API3 Goes Live on Bitget

Security, robustness, cost efficiency, and flexibility are the cornerstones of API3's design. The elimination of third-party oracles, collateralized service coverage, and a DAO-driven governance model position API3 as a secure, transparent, and cost-effective solution for the next generation of decentralized applications.

How to Trade API3 on Bitget

Step 1: Go to API3USDT spot trading page;

Step 2: Enter the amount and the type of order, then click Buy/Sell.

For detailed instructions on how to spot trade in Bitget, please read The Uncensored Guide To Bitget Spot Trading.

API3 represents a leap forward in the evolution of decentralized applications. By connecting dApps with the vast data and services offered by traditional Web APIs, API3 empowers developers to build applications that interact with the off-chain world in a truly decentralized and trust-minimized way.

Trade API3 on Bitget now!

Disclaimer: The opinions expressed in this article are for informational purposes only. This article does not constitute an endorsement of any of the products and services discussed or investment, financial, or trading advice. Qualified professionals should be consulted prior to making financial decisions.